The model described by Bewick et al seems to be able to distinguish between H1N1 influenza-related pneumonia and non-H1N1 community acquired pneumonia (CAP) based on five criteria. However, bacterial infection in the influenza group has not been accurately excluded. Therefore, this model could misidentify these patients and lead to an inappropriate treatment. We conducted a prospective observational study to compare mixed pneumonia vs viral pneumonia. In the mixed pneumonia group patients were older, had higher levels of procalcitonine and higher scores of severity. In our cohort the model proposed by Bewick et al would not identify patients with coinfection.  相似文献

Background:

Persons with spinal cord injuries and disorders (SCI/D) are at high risk for respiratory complications from influenza. During pandemic situations, where resources may be scarce, uncertainties may arise in veterans with SCI/D.

Objective:

To describe concerns, knowledge, and perceptions of information received during the 2009-2010 H1N1 influenza pandemic and to examine variables associated with H1N1 vaccine receipt.

Methods:

In August 2010, a cross-sectional survey was mailed to a national sample of veterans with traumatic and nontraumatic SCI/D.

Results:

During the pandemic, 58% of veterans with SCI/D received the H1N1 vaccine. Less than two-thirds of non-H1N1 vaccine recipients indicated intentions to get the next season’s influenza vaccine. Being ≥50 years of age and depressed were significantly associated with higher odds of H1N1 vaccination. Being worried about vaccine side effects was associated with lower odds of H1N1 receipt. Compared to individuals who reported receiving an adequate amount of information about the pandemic, those who received too little information had significantly lower odds of receiving the H1N1 vaccine. Those who received accurate/clear information (vs confusing/conflicting) had 2 times greater odds of H1N1 vaccine receipt.

Conclusions:

H1N1 influenza vaccination was low in veterans with SCI/D. Of H1N1 vaccine nonrecipients, only 63% intend to get a seasonal vaccine next season. Providing an adequate amount of accurate and clear information is vital during uncertain times, as was demonstrated by the positive associations with H1N1 vaccination. Information-sharing efforts are needed, so that carry-over effects from the pandemic do not avert future healthy infection prevention behaviors.  相似文献

Pregnancy, with or without additional complications, constitutes a high-risk condition for complications of influenza infection and warrants early intervention with neuraminidase inhibitors such as oseltamivir, if influenza is suspected. Treatment should not be delayed for laboratory confirmation. In South Africa, the high burden of HIV infection is a further complication.  相似文献

Six cases of bacterial tracheitis (BT) occurring early in the 2009 flu season have been isolated in conjunction with the H1N1 strain of influenza A (H1N1). No previous H1N1 cases have presented as BT in the literature to date. We would like to discuss viral coinfection in BT patients and how this new strain may affect the rate and type of presentation encountered. The life-threatening potential of BT and the pandemic proportion of H1N1 highlight a possibly dangerous combination that should be recognized by the otolaryngology community. In hospitalized patients with presumed BT, consideration should be given to routine H1N1 testing and the addition of antiviral medication when indicated as this entity is further investigated.  相似文献

Background

Solid organ transplant recipients undergoing immunosuppressive therapy are considered to be at high risk of serious infectious complications. In 2009, a new influenza pandemic caused serious infections and deaths, especially among children and immunocompromised patients. Herein we have reported the safety and efficacy of a single-shot monovalent whole-virus vaccine against H1N1 infection in the pediatric renal transplant population.

Methods

In November and December 2009, we vaccinated 37 renal transplant children and adolescents and measured their antibody responses. Seroprotection, seroconversion, and seroconversion factors were analyzed at 21 days after vaccination.

Results

None of the vaccinated patients experienced vaccine-related side effects. None of the patients had an H1N1 influenza infection after vaccination. All of the patients showed elevations in antibody titer at 21 days after vaccination. In contrast, only 29.72% of the patients achieved a safe seroprotection level and only 18.75% a safe seroconversion rate. More intense immunosuppressive treatment displayed negative effect on seroprotection and seroconversion, and antibody production significantly increased with age. No other factor was observed to influence seroprotection.

Conclusions

We recommend vaccination of children and adolescent renal transplant recipients against H1N1 virus. However, a single shot of vaccine may not be sufficient; to achieve seroprotection, a booster vaccination and measurement of the antibody response are needed to assure protection of our patients.  相似文献

Influenza pandemics have been observed in several periods throughout history. The first influenza pandemic of the 21st century began in Mexico in 2009 and has spread rapidly all over the world. Swine H1N1 has been officially declared a pandemic by the World Health Organization in June 2009. As has been observed in previous pandemics, pregnant women, adolescents, and immunosuppressed individuals are affected more severely in this pandemic. Despite several reports about the pandemic, there have not been any reports of swine H1N1 infection in individuals who underwent renal transplant. The aim of the current study was to present oseltamivir therapy in a swine H1N1-infected patient who underwent renal transplant 10 months earlier, and was thus under immunosuppressive treatment. To the best of our knowledge, this is the first case report of a swine H1N1 infection in a renal transplant recipient.  相似文献

甲型H1N1流感在世界范围内的暴发已被广泛报道。截至7月27日22时,WHO确认甲型H1N1流感病毒已在全球160个国家感染,已有816例患者死亡。目前,仍不断有新发病例出现。为尽快了解其相关特性,总结防治经验,现对温州市收治的27例甲型H1N1流感确诊病例进行了回顾性分析。  相似文献

Despite a much higher rate of human influenza A (H7N9) infection compared to influenza A (H5N1), and the assumption that birds are the source of human infection, detection rates of H7N9 in birds are lower than those of H5N1. This raises a question about the role of birds in the spread and transmission of H7N9 to humans. We conducted a meta‐analysis of overall prevalence of H5N1 and H7N9 in different bird populations (domestic poultry, wild birds) and different environments (live bird markets, commercial poultry farms, wild habitats). The electronic database, Scopus, was searched for published papers, and Google was searched for country surveillance reports. A random effect meta‐analysis model was used to produce pooled estimates of the prevalence of H5N1 and H7N9 for various subcategories. A random effects logistic regression model was used to compare prevalence rates between H5N1 and H7N9. Both viruses have low prevalence across all bird populations. Significant differences in prevalence rates were observed in domestic birds, farm settings, for pathogen and antibody testing, and during routine surveillance. Random effects logistic regression analyses show that among domestic birds, the prevalence of H5N1 is 47.48 (95% CI: 17.15–133.13, P < 0.001) times higher than H7N9. In routine surveillance (where surveillance was not conducted in response to human infections or bird outbreaks), the prevalence of H5N1 is still higher than H7N9 with an OR of 43.02 (95% CI: 16.60–111.53, P < 0.001). H7N9 in humans has occurred at a rate approximately four times higher than H5N1, and for both infections, birds are postulated to be the source. Much lower rates of H7N9 in birds compared to H5N1 raise doubts about birds as the sole source of high rates of human H7N9 infection. Other sources of transmission of H7N9 need to be considered and explored.  相似文献
